Felix Meritis Building in Amsterdam. Image by i29.
This unique building on Keizersgracht was built in 1788 for a society of scientists, artists, entrepreneurs and thinkers. Regarded a hotspot for creativity and crossovers during intellectual movements such as “The Enlightenment” ?an 18th-century coalition that emphasized reason and science ? the building was home to five different departments and facilitated space for music, commerce, literature, physics and drawing.
Reimagining the grand spaces of Amsterdam?s iconic Felix Meritis building, Dutch interior architecture studio i29 adds a contemporary touch to an already vibrant history, creating a colorful revamp that has since transformed the 18th-century style rooms through merging historical allure with modern design sophistication.
Commissioned by investment group Amerborgh, i29 was tasked to further the complete interior redesign of the space by end 2020.
